
Sistem blog open source berdasarkan .NET dan Alibaba Cloud.
Situs web pribadi saat ini,






Jika Anda menggunakan Visual Studio (bukan kode studio visual), Anda tidak perlu menginstal Libman CLI dan Entity Framework CLI.
Instal Libman Cli :
dotnet tool install -g Microsoft.Web.LibraryManager.CliInstal Entity Framework Core CLI
dotnet tool install -g dotnet-efKode Sumber Klon
git clone https://github.com/lixinyang123/CoreHome.gitKonfigurasi
Anda dapat merujuk ke blog ini untuk dikonfigurasi.
Isi appsettings.json di
CoreHome.HomePagedanCoreHome.Adminpersis sama, cukup salin dan tempel.
Baik corehome.homepage dan file corehome.admin's application.json harus dikonfigurasi.
"CoreHome": "server=[host];user id=[user];password=[password];database=corehome"
Studio Visual
Visual Studio Code atau CLI
dotnet restore di direktori berikut.libman restore di direktori berikut.Tools -> Nuget Package Manager -> Paket Manajer Konsol
Update-Database Jalankan perintah berikut di CoreHome.HomePage dan CoreHome.Admin Directory.
dotnet-ef database update -p .. C oreHome.Data Klik Startup di Solution Explorer atau Ctrl+F5 .
Jalankan perintah berikut di CoreHome.HomePage dan CoreHome.Admin Directory.
dotnet run Klik Build Dockerfile di Solution Explorer.
Jalankan perintah berikut di direktori root proyek.
docker build --file ./CoreHome.Admin/Dockerfile --tag lixinyang/corehome-admin:latest .
docker build --file ./CoreHome.HomePage/Dockerfile --tag lixinyang/corehome-homepage:latest .
docker build --file ./CoreHome.ReverseProxy/Dockerfile --tag lixinyang/corehome-reverseproxy:latest . Anda dapat menggunakan DockerHome untuk menggunakan Corehome, atau Anda dapat menggunakannya secara manual.
Anda dapat merujuk ke blog ini untuk menggunakan DockerHome.